“Knight Fight” steps inside the world of the full-contact Armored Combat League - often referred to as “Medieval MMA” or “Knight Fight Club.” This blood sport is a full-contact armored combat league where modern-day warriors battle in over eighty pounds of plated armor with real steel weapons.

Most swords are named after the word for sword in their respective languages. A Persian scimitar is known as a shamshir which means sword. A Japanese sword is known as a katana which means sword. A Turkish scimitar is known as a kilij which means sword. And this is the same for Indian swords. In fact, I'm pretty sure the term "scimitar" was rarely used historically. Most cultures would just call it "sword" in their respective languages.

I think the problem is sword classification is either utterly vague and useless IE: "longsword" or "Sabre" Or it so hyper specific that minor modifications demand entirely new terms like in the Oakeshott typology. "Scimitar" exists with two given definitions these days. The first is the denotative definition which your citing in which the scimitar is a very specific blade design factoring in everything from guard shape to the presence of a false back-edge. The second is the connotative wherein western predominately Eurocentric blade design classifies all blades of this design tradition as a "scimitar" which I think is what they are using in the video.
